Which reporting feature in GA4 allows businesses to visualize user journey data?

The Path Analysis feature in Google Analytics 4 provides businesses the ability to visualize user journey data effectively. This tool allows users to see the paths visitors take through their website or app, helping to illustrate how users navigate between different pages or events. By presenting the data in a graphical format, businesses can easily identify common pathways, drop-off points, and successful user flows, which can inform strategies for optimizing user experience and improving conversions.

On the other hand, the Real-time Report focuses on immediate user interactions and activity occurring on the site or app at any given moment. While this information is valuable, it does not provide a comprehensive visualization of journey data over time. The Audience Overview report offers insights into the demographic and behavioral characteristics of users but does not display user paths or journeys. Finally, the Attribution Report provides insights into how traffic sources contribute to conversions, focusing on credit allocation rather than the actual paths taken by users. Therefore, for visualizing the user journey, Path Analysis is the most suitable feature.
